CLIFFORD CHANCE BUSINESS SERVICES

JOB DESCRIPTION

Job Title Senior Software Engineer

Location Ambience Island, NH-8, Gurgaon, or

Gachibowli, Hyderabad

Business Area Enterprise Core Systems

Job Type Permanent

Career band Assistant

Role type Administration Assistant

Days/Hours of Work Monday to Friday, General or U.K Hrs (Working Hrs need to be flexible as
per business requirement)

Reports to Senior Manager

Workday Developer is the key contributor for HR Systems team who needs to provide support on
HR & Learning Workday application. Incumbent will be handling entire SDLC using SAFe (Agile)
methodology along with functional / technical knowledge, problem solving skills and innovative
ideas. Incumbent has to manage the Change Request process and ensuring that technical
assessments and specifications are produced for the development team to use for coding.

This role demands someone with high analytical ability and who is highly committed and motivated.
The person should have good communication skills, excellent at removing impediments and
breaking down complex tasks into simple easy to complete milestones, willing to jump in and solve
the problem.

How you will influence:

- Solve complex business problems using functional / technical knowledge

- Improve the overall applications health of the applications by ensuring compliance to


maintenance schedule / upgrade to latest standards and guidelines

What you will be doing:

- Configuration and Development of HR & Learning portfolio Workday application

- Testing of HR Applications

- Performing peer reviews

- Deployment and Packaging

What we need:

- 4-5 yrs. extensive hands on experience and understanding in the workday ERP application

- Extensive experience with Workday Project Lifecyle

- Experience with common integration problems, such as security, and various application
support approaches

- Deep knowledge of XML Schema and XPATH

- Experience as a technical consultant in the following skills of Workday – EIB, Studio,


Document Transformation, Core HCM / Payroll Connectors, Calculated Fields, XSLT / XML,
Web Services API

- Basic developer knowledge of Web Services (understanding of SOAP, WSDL and close
relationship to Schema language) integration using Web Service toolkits or platforms
(WSDL consumer)

- Work directly with key business and IT stakeholders to gather requirements, design,
consider design alternatives, facilitate discussions and provide out of the box solution

- Workday Custom Reports and Calculated Fields , Workday Integration tools Core
Connector, DT, EIB and Workday studio , Workday public APIs , Web service tech REST,
JSON, SOAP, HTTP , Integrating third party systems such LMS, ERP, Active Directory, and
middleware systems, Building complex Studio, XSLT along with Error handling , SFTP, PGP
encryption and authentication methods and Payroll and Benefit integrations

- Analyze Workday release updates to understand impacts of feature changes, in relation


to clients existing configuration

- Techno-Functional knowledge of one or more Workday modules. Examples: HCM,


Absence Management, Compensation, Benefits, Payroll interface

- Experience developing multiple integrations to/from HR/Benefits/Payroll applications

- Self-motivated and ability to learn quickly through individual research and self-training

- Effective knowledge transfer skills in non-classroom environment.

- Excellent English verbal and written communication skills

- Experience as a techno functional consultant with ERP background in Workday

- Experience in HCM processes

- Very strong communication skills are required. Must be capable of interacting with
solution architects, other technology teams to identify technology opportunities

Education and Experience

- Requires Bachelors in Engineering Degree or equivalent, and strong relevant professional


experience.
